RPL is an assessment process that acknowledges an individual’s prior learning, experience, skills and knowledge in the working environment where it is relevant to their chosen qualification. An RTO can provide credit against units of competency, often shorting the time required to complete a qualification.

Get in TouchWhat is Recognition of Prior Learning?
Recognition of Prior Learning (RPL) allows learners to be credited for all, or part of, their nationally recognised qualification by demonstrating skills, understanding and experience in a particular field of work.
